NFL will never happen. Not while DirecTV holds exclusive rights to NFL Sunday Ticket. I'll say this bit again. The only reason this happened was because MLB developed an app for the PS3 for use in conjunction with their EXISTING MLB.tv web service. NBA and NHL do not have existing services. In order for the PS3 to have a similar app for either of those leagues, the NBA/NHL will have to first develop a web service similar to MLB's. Without that it's just not going to happen. And the reason this became an app in the first place was because of the overwhelming success of the MLB.tv web service to begin with.

MLB app is pretty effing awesome for most baseball fans. For around $100 you have access to ALL games. The only ones blacked out are local games, which almost anyone should be able to watch on their standard cable packages anyway. The key here is HD streaming of any and all out of market baseball games. And the reason why this is an app is because MLB.tv already exists as a web service. As far as I know none of the other sports (NFL, NHL, NBA) have web services that allow access to all out of market games. And by the way, any local game for any sport would be blacked out live on a service like this. If it's a good service, though, the service will offer the game archived immediately after it's over.
